ADMISSIONS REQUIREMENTS BY GRADE LEVEL
Application to Preschool (2-Day Program, age 27 months by June 1st or 3-Day Program, age 3 by June 1st)
- Application and application fee
- Preschool Parent Questionnaire
- Teacher Recommendation - give form to the current teacher or care giver to complete and submit.
- Parent Interview (scheduled after application is received).
- Half Hour Student Visit (scheduled after complete application is received). This visit is composed of a small group of applicants who visit together for one half hour of play activities.
Application to PrePrimary (age 4 by June 1st)
- Application and application fee
- Preschool Parent Questionnaire
- Teacher Recommendation - give form to the current teacher to complete and submit.
- Parent Interview (scheduled after application is received).
- 45 minute Student Visit (scheduled after complete application is received). This visit is composed of a small group of applicants who visit together for 45 minutes of play activities.
Application to Primary (Kindergarten age children, age 5 by June 1st)
- Application and application fee
- Teacher Recommendation - give form to the current teacher to complete and submit.
- One Hour Student Visit (scheduled after complete application is received). This visit is composed of a small group of applicants who visit together for one hour of assessment activities.
Application to Grades 1-6
- Application and application fee
- Teacher Recommendation - give form to the current teacher to complete and submit.
- Transcripts from the previous 2 years - sign and give the Transcript Request Form to your current school.
- Standardized Test Scores
- Applicants to Grade 1 are invited to visit as a group for two hours on Saturday, February 12, 2011. Appointment time will be scheduled after application is complete.
- Applicants to Grades 2-6 are invited to visit during the school day for a full day. During that time, they will visit in the classroom of their current grade level where they will meet current students, experience the school environment and complete various assessment activities.
